KVK Doda starts training programme on INM for agricultural input dealers
9/15/2021 11:14:53 PM

EARLY TIMES REPORT

DODA, Sept 15: Krishi Vigyan Kendra (KVK) Doda, SKUAST Jammu started 15 days training programme on Integrated Nutrient Management (INM) for agricultural input dealers at Bhaderwah today. The programme was conducted under the guidance of Dr JP Sharma, Vice Chancellor, SKUAST Jammu and was organized by the team of scientists of KVK Doda under the leadership of Dr SK Gupta, Director Extension SKUAST Jammu. Trainees from district Doda and Kishtwar joined the programme.
The programme started with welcome address by Dr Narinder Paul, Scientist KVK Doda. Dr AS Charak, Senior Scientist and Head KVK Doda briefed the participants about the content and outline of 15 days programme schedule and highlighted the importance of the programme for the fertilizer dealers. Amjad Hussain Malik, Saffron Development Officer, hailed the SKUAST Jammu for organizing the programme at KVK which he added will benefit not only the input dealers but also the farmers of the twin districts.
During the first day of the programme Dr Narinder Paul delivered the lecture on essential nutrients and their role in plant nutrition. Dr AS Charak deliberated and demonstrated the collection of soil sample for its testing. Various queries of the participants were also answered by the organizers. Technical session ended with the vote of thanks by Dr GN Jha, Scientist KVK Doda.
